OverviewThis Software House security and event management software portfolio centers on C•CURE IQ and C•CURE 9000. It supports on‑premises, hybrid and cloud deployments and is extended by a wide range of tested integrations via the Software House Connected Partner Program.
Key points- C•CURE IQ evolves from C•CURE 9000 into a single, comprehensive integration platform for on‑premises, hybrid and cloud environments.
- The C•CURE suite is the core of the Software House system and integrates with iSTAR controllers and multiple reader technologies.
- Provides tailored solutions when combined with American Dynamics, Exacq VMS and Illustra or other qualified cameras.

Technical specifications- Deployment: on‑premises, hybrid and cloud (including dedicated single‑tenant Cloud options).
- Scalability: single server configurations documented up to 5,000 readers per server and distributed architectures with up to 60 satellite application servers.
- Clients: C•CURE IQ (browser‑based); C•CURE Go for mobile monitoring and control.
- Security Intelligence: dashboards, dynamic alarm prioritisation, spatial analytics, reporting and forensic search to reduce alarm noise.
- Interoperability: native integrations with American Dynamics and Exacq VMS; support for Illustra and other qualified cameras; broad partner ecosystem.
- High Assurance: C•CURE HA addresses government credential/authentication requirements (PIV/PIV‑I/CAC/CIV/TWIC, SP800‑116, FIPS 201, HSPD‑12) and supports smartcards, PINs and biometrics.
- High availability: Stratus everRun, everRun Enterprise and everRun Express options for continuous virtualisation and system uptime.
- Credential management: cardholder lifecycle, self‑service workflows, access request automation and policy enforcement (Access Management Workflow).
